4 frame street reporter comic. the reporter, off frame, asks someone waiting for the subway, with a dark long jacket, a gold and red scarf and round glasses : miss! any thoughts about the newest study showing that trans people's mental health deteriorates after starting gender-affirming treatment? she replies : kaltiala's paper didn't measure mental health deterioration. it measured how many trans people visited a psychiatrist after getting their diagnosis from the finnish gender clinic, which forces trans people to be screened extensively every 3-6 months during their treatment. this paper counts any visit to a psychiatrist, including when the patient is cleared of any issue, as a sign of "mental health deterioration". that metho- dological flaw is mentioned in the paper*, but that didn't stop any of these powerful anti-trans bigots to share it online. *erin in the morning : "Fact Check: New Finnish "Study" Does Not Prove "Trans Youth Care Leads To Worse Outcomes" *kehraaja.com (in Finnish)
